VICTORIA. Local Forces Badge for Military Engineering. Silver arm badge with scrolls for 1877, 1878 & 1881. Mounted together on silk cloth with a hand coloured photograph by Waddington & Co, Elizabeth St, Melbourne of recipient in uniform wearing the badge. Very fine.

This badge was awarded following the successful examination in such military subjects as the destruction of stockades by gunpowder, a knowledge of escalading, field telegraph, military mining, etc.
